Lester Oliveros was a professional baseball P who played from 2011 to 2014. Oliveros played 27 games in the major leagues, hitting .000 with 0 home runs. A right-handed, Oliveros stood 6'0" tall and brought athleticism and dedication to his position. Born in Maracay, Aragua, Oliveros made significant contributions to baseball.
